Part P Registration
Part P of the Building Regulations covers all electrical work carried out within the house, flat or maisonette or on land attached to the dwelling. It also covers work carried out in business premises that share an electrical supply with a dwelling, such as shops and public buildings with an apartment above.
The regulations apply to all electrical works that are notifiable, including any changes or additions made to the circuits in a bathroom or a kitchen as well as all outdoor installations as well as new consumer appliances. Notifiable electrical works will be criminal unless executed by a registered and qualified electrician who complies with Part P's requirements.
Only electrical work that is subject to notification must be reported to the local authority. This includes any work that requires the creation of a new connection to an electrical supply or circuit in an apartment, home, or maisonette.
It is vital to have your electrical work completed by an expert who has the proper equipment, qualifications and knowledge. They'll have the appropriate test equipment and the BS7671:2018 document. Requirements for electrical installations 18th edition as well as 2391.
This also means that they notify the Building Control Officer if they are performing work which is subject to notification. The work will be inspected by a third-party and then certified. This is a crucial requirement of Part P and assures you that the work is compliant.
